2. Distillation
The distillation process is crucial in creating a high-quality vodka. This process involves heating the fermented ingredients to create alcohol vapor, which is then condensed back into liquid form. The number of times the liquid is distilled can greatly impact the final product. The highest quality vodkas often undergo multiple distillations to refine the alcohol and remove any impurities, resulting in a cleaner and smoother spirit.

3. Filtration
Filtration is another key step in creating a top-tier vodka. The liquid is passed through various filtration methods, such as activated charcoal or quartz sand, to remove any remaining impurities and create a clean and crisp taste. The best vodkas undergo filtration multiple times to achieve a pure and smooth final product.

4. Water
Water quality is essential in creating a high-quality vodka. The best vodkas use purified water sourced from natural springs or aquifers, which adds to the overall purity and smoothness of the spirit. Water is often added to the vodka after distillation to bring it to the desired proof, so using high-quality water is crucial in maintaining the integrity of the vodka.
